Currently, the existing roof which supports the slate is framed with 2x6 rafters spaced at 20-inches on center. This rafter size and spacing would be considered undersized based on current design practices. Furthermore, the addition of insulation within the home (required to meet the urrent ene 0 - ead to an increased snow load on the existing roof and increase the stress on the existing rafters. Because of this, it may be advantageous to the project to consider removing the existing slate roofing and replacing this material with a lighter weight roofing, such as asphalt shingles.
